Meg + Scott Wedding | Trump Hotel Chicago | PFC Milton Olive Park | North Avenue Beach

maybe it is the fact that meg is teacher ~ maybe it's that we both trust the same amazing hair stylist, tommy, to do our hair ~ maybe it's that she collects vintage purses ~ maybe it's that you can talk to meg for one minute and feel relaxed, like you are chatting with an old friend ~ or perhaps it is her huge heart and warm personality ~ or perhaps it was all of the above that made me so freakin' excited to photograph her wedding!! yep, that's it. it was all of the above!  

meg and her mom, mary, met me in bucktown at one of my fave hangouts, cortland's garage. over burgers and beer we got to know one another and the longer we talked the more i got excited about sharing in her and scott's wedding day.  

meg + scott wanted a simple wedding. something small and romantic. something personal. they nailed it!  we started at the trump hotel chicago and the ladies [ myself include...thanks mary :) ] noshed on a yummy lunch. the gents, just a few floors above, sipped, what i was told to be a very fine bourbon.  we held their first look on the side walk just outside the hotel and then headed to the lakeshore [ pfc milton olive park ] for an intimate ceremony with meg + scott's parents, meg's brother, myself and reverend jim.  there was not a dry eye and tears streamed down my face as well.  this wedding was very special. and i was honored to be invited to share in this awesome wedding.

we all hoped back into the limo and headed to north avenue beach for some portraits along the lake.  the weather was beautiful and i always love to hear strangers express their happiness to the newlyweds.  

meg, scott and their family had a lovely dinner at le bouchon in bucktown and then headed back to their suite at the trump where they were joined by some friends to continue the celebration.  meg told me that the other patrons at the restaurant cheered as their cake was brought out and that they had an amazing day!!
